We collect data all the time! In schools, in apps, in games — even when you fill in your name online. But how exactly is data collected?
📱 Digital Collection Methods
📝 Forms — when you sign up or answer questions
🎮 Games — when you play, they collect your score or level
📦 Online shops — what you buy or search
📍 Phones — collect your location (with permission!)
💡 Tip: Some apps ask for your data. Always ask an adult before accepting!
👀 Observing and Measuring
Not all data is typed! Sometimes we collect data by:
👁️ Watching how people use a website
🎤 Listening to sounds or speech
📷 Capturing images or video
📚 Did you know? Some websites use “cookies” to remember what you clicked!
🔐 Be Smart with Data
It’s okay to share data — but only when it’s safe. Never give out private information like your home address or password without help from a trusted adult.
